Associated Student Body (ASB)

The purpose of the Associated Student Body (ASB) is to promote good citizenship, to encourage a high standard of scholarship, to arouse a spirit of pride within our school, to demonstrate the practical amount of democracy, to contribute to the welfare of the school and community, and to promote cooperation between the faculty and students.

SB Meetings
ASB Meetings will be held twice a month although these meetings are subject to change due to school activities. Each Social Studies class will elect two representatives and an alternate to attend monthly ASB meetings. If one of the representatives is elected as an officer, then a new alternate will be elected.
